  • Patent number: 10187623
    Abstract: A stereo vision SoC and a processing method thereof are provided. The stereo vision SoC extracts first support points from an image and adds second support points, performs triangulation based on the first support points and the second support points; and extracts disparity using a result of the triangulation. Accordingly, depth image quality is improved and HW is easily implemented in the stereo vision SoC.

  • Publication number: 20190001788
    Abstract: An air conditioner for a vehicle includes an air conditioning case having a first air passageway and a second air passageway partitioned by a separator therein; a PTC heater disposed in each of the first air passageway and the second air passageway to generate heat by electric energy; and a control unit for controlling operation of the PTC heater. The control unit individually controls discharge temperature of the first air passageway and discharge temperature of the second air passageway of the PTC heater, and if target discharge temperature of the first air passageway and target discharge temperature of the second air passageway are different from each other, the control unit calculates and outputs a compensation value for the PTC heater output of at least one of the first air passageway and the second air passageway. The PTC heater therefore has a reduced output when controlling for dual temperatures.

  • Publication number: 20180363737
    Abstract: A vehicle transmission is provided that improves fuel efficiency through multiple speed stages and enhances silent drivability of a vehicle using an operating point in a low RPM range of an engine. The vehicle transmission combines three simple planetary gear units with a single compound planetary gear set or combines five simple planetary gear units to shift gears while changing rotational speeds and directions by a selective intermittence operation using rotation elements of the planetary gear units and a plurality of friction elements. Through such a shift operation, it is possible to form at least forward 10-speed or more and reverse 1-speed gear ratios for driving of the vehicle.
